docs/docs/guides/external-library.md
This guide walks you through adding an External Library. This guide assumes you are running Immich in Docker and that the files you wish to access are stored in a directory on the same machine.
Edit docker-compose.yml to add one or more new mount points in the section immich-server: under volumes:.
If you want Immich to be able to delete the images in the external library or add metadata (XMP sidecars), remove :ro from the end of the mount point.
immich-server:
volumes:
- ${UPLOAD_LOCATION}:/data
+ - /home/user/photos1:/home/user/photos1:ro
+ - /mnt/photos2:/mnt/photos2:ro # you can delete this line if you only have one mount point, or you can add more lines if you have more than two
Restart Immich by running docker compose up -d.
:::info External library management requires administrator access and the steps below assume you are using an admin account. :::
In the Immich web UI:
click the Administration link in the upper right corner.
Select the External Libraries tab and click the Create Library button
In the dialog, select which user should own the new library
You are now entering the library management page.
Click Add in the Folder section to specify a path for scanning and enter /home/user/photos1 as the path and click Add
Click the three-dots menu and select Scan New Library Files
Click Administration
Select the Jobs tab
You should see non-zero Active jobs for Library, Generate Thumbnails, and Extract Metadata.
